Job Description:

Social care professionals play a vital role in supporting individuals with physical or intellectual disabilities, autism, and other support needs to lead fulfilling lives.

Our organisation delivers person-centred care across 12 residential communities and four-day services nationwide, making a profound impact on the lives of those we support.

We are seeking experienced professionals to join our team in supporting adults towards independent living and community integration.

* Hold a minimum of a Level 7 qualification on the QQI Framework – BA in Social Care Studies or equivalent qualification in healthcare or social care.
* Have one year's experience of working with vulnerable adults or adults with intellectual disabilities.
* Experience working with challenging behaviours.
* Strong knowledge of legislation protecting vulnerable adults.
* A full, clean manual driver's license and own car availability for this post are required.
* Understanding of current policy and developments at national and sectoral level in relation to social care within disability services.
* Ability to follow, evaluate and contribute to the development of plans and methods meeting ongoing individual needs.
* Effective interpersonal and communication (verbal and written) skills.
* Proficient IT skills relevant to the role, including Microsoft Office Excel, Word, SharePoint, OneDrive and Teams.
